Three Crowns Milk unveils ‘Treasure Your Heart’ campaign for Ramadan

Three Crowns milk, Nigeria’s leading low-cholesterol and heart-friendly milk brand, is launching the “Treasure Your Heart this Ramadan” campaign to encourage Muslim faithfuls to stay nourished and keep their hearts safe during the holy period of fasting.

The campaign, which starts on March 22nd, will feature several activities, including mosque activations and giveaways of special Three Crowns Ramadan gift bags to consumers across the country. Additionally, Three Crowns milk will partner with renowned Muslim influencers for Instagram live sessions to educate Muslims on the importance of Ramadan and staying healthy by incorporating low-cholesterol and heart-friendly Three Crowns milk into their diets throughout Ramadan and beyond. The live sessions will also include Q&A segments for consumers to win prizes.

According to Gloria Jacobs, Marketing Manager for Three Crowns Milk, abstaining from Sahur to Iftar during Ramadan is a religious requirement for all Muslims, and food is the main and most affordable personal indulgence for Muslims during Ramadan. Hence, high-quality milk like Three Crowns is a necessity during the fast as it provides low-cholesterol nourishment and nutrient replenishment to keep hearts safe and replenish lost nutrients.

As part of the campaign, Three Crowns milk will partner with renowned Muslim chefs to create healthy Ramadan recipes using Three Crowns milk. The brand will also be present at major mosques across the country to serve nourishing Three Crowns milk and fruits to Muslims in mosques and prayer grounds throughout Ramadan.
